Transfer Analysis

A comprehensive look at Al Wahda's transfer activity over the past decade.

Transfer Activity

How active has Al Wahda been in the transfer market over the past decade?

Al Wahda has been moderately active in the transfer market, completing 24 transfers over the past 5 seasons. This includes 13 incoming moves and 11 departures. The most active season was 2024/25 with 11 transactions, while 2022/23 saw just 2.

Transfer Spending

A breakdown of investment and sales revenue across each season.

Over the past decade, Al Wahda has invested a total of €7.6M in incoming transfers while recouping €0 from player sales. This results in a net spend of €7.6M, making the club a balanced in the market. The club's biggest spending season was 2024/25 with €4.3M invested.

Transfer Window Patterns

When does Al Wahda prefer to do their business?

Al Wahda is conducting almost all business in summer. The summer window accounts for 83% of all transfer activity (20 moves), compared to 17% in January (4 moves). Summer spending totals €7.6M vs €0 in winter windows.

Positions Targeted

Which areas of the squad has Al Wahda invested in?

Al Wahda's recruitment has been heavily focused on attacker recruitment, with Attackers representing 54% of incoming transfers (7 signings). Midfielder arrivals account for another 31% (4 players).

Positions Sold From

Where has Al Wahda seen the most outgoing activity?

The club has seen most departures from Attacker positions (55%, 6 players), followed by Midfielders at 27% (3 players). Both incoming and outgoing activity has been concentrated in attacker positions, suggesting squad rebuilding in this area.

Biggest Signings

The most expensive players to arrive at Al Wahda.

The most significant investment was Philip Otele for €3.5M, arriving from CFR Cluj in 2024. Fábio Martins (€3.0M) and Favour Inyeka Ogbu (€800K) complete the top three. The total spent on these top signings represents 96% of all incoming transfer fees.

Free Transfers

How much value has Al Wahda found in the free agent market?

Free transfers have accounted for 69% of incoming moves over the past decade. Notable free signings include Darko Lazović, Dušan Tadić, Lucas Vera. In total, Al Wahda has brought in 9 players without a transfer fee.

Loan Movements

How has Al Wahda utilized the loan market?

Al Wahda has utilized the loan market frequently in both directions, sending out 7 players and bringing in 7 on temporary deals over the decade. The most loan activity came in 2024/25 with 8 moves.
